I brought one of my spare 3D printers to work for others to use. Several of them liked the razor handle I provided for cleanup of the bed when plastic sticks down to the PEI too well. That handle was by Walter Hsiao, Walter was a part of the HercuLien/Eustathios printer group back in the G+ days. His handle is a great design and some of the guys wanted one for non-printer reasons. But… they wanted some changes. So I remodeled a razor handle inspired by Walter's design but built from scratch to provide the features they wanted added.
Here is the new design handle with a ridge for your thumb when scraping, textured top, finger ridges underneath, and a snap on cover/cap for transport.
Walters original design is certainly more flowing, elegant, and simplified to it purest form. This design on the other hand takes the direction of function first. Plus I could never compete with Walters design aesthetic, he is a master.
Anyway I hope you find it useful. I have included the Solidworks 2018 native file, a STEP export, and the STL.
